What is SocialBee?

SocialBee is a social media scheduler built around content recycling: you sort posts into content categories, build a category-based calendar, and let evergreen posts re-publish automatically with expiration rules. It covers 10+ networks and adds an AI content assistant, RSS curation, analytics with PDF reports, a social inbox and agency workspaces with approvals. It is designed to automate consistent, always-on posting of your own content, not to discover what is going viral across networks.

What SocialBee is for

Category-based scheduling with evergreen recycling, across ten or more networks, plus an AI content assistant and RSS curation, from about $29/mo. Agencies get multi-workspace plans and approvals. If your content library keeps its value over time, the recycling engine is the product and it is a good one.

Two doors that closed in 2026

SocialBee retired its public API and its browser extension. Both are worth knowing about before committing, because they are the kind of thing you only miss once your workflow depends on them: no programmatic pushing of content in from your own systems, and no clipping from the web as you browse.

If either was part of why you were considering it, the tool you are evaluating is not the tool that was reviewed a year ago.

Recycling assumes evergreen, and most libraries are not

A recycler will republish whatever you filed, faithfully, including the post about a feature that shipped, a price that changed or a platform that no longer exists. For genuinely timeless content that is the whole point. For everything else it is a slow-motion accuracy problem.

Worth counting honestly how much of your library is evergreen before paying for an engine built around the assumption that most of it is.

Engagement is not listening

SocialBee gives you a social inbox for replying to what arrives. It has no social listening and no discovery, so nothing in it is watching the networks for content worth making.
